Prima facie means “at first sight” or “on the face of it”. Maingot offers the following definition: “A prima facie case of privilege in the parliamentary sense is one where the evidence on its face as outlined by the Member is sufficiently strong for the House to be asked to debate the matter and to send it to a committee to investigate whether the privileges of the House have been breached or a contempt has occurred and report to the House” (2 ed., p. 221).

The second edition of Maingot's Parliamentary Privilege in Canada states, on page 42, that parliamentary privilege protects the member “when he speaks in Parliament, but when he speaks outside, or publishes outside what he says inside Parliament, Parliament offers no protection; only the common law does, if it is offered at all”.
